ECARX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:ECX – Get Rating) – Research analysts at Cantor Fitzgerald issued their FY2023 earnings per share estimates for ECARX in a research note issued on Monday, May 22nd. Cantor Fitzgerald analyst D. Soderberg anticipates that the company will post earnings per share of ($0.38) for the year. Cantor Fitzgerald has a “Overweight” rating and a $10.00 price objective on the stock.

ECARX Company Profile
ECARX Holdings, Inc engages in the design, development, and delivery of vehicle technology. Its products include infotainment head units, digital cockpits, vehicle chip-set, operating system and software stack. The company was founded in 2017 and is based in Shanghai, China with an additional office in Europe.
